Papilledema is swelling of your optic nerve, which connects the eye and brain. This swelling is a reaction to a buildup of pressure in or around your brain that may have many causes.

Funduscopic examination demonstrated marked papilledema, with retinal hemorrhages, retinal edema, and the deposition of exudate in a star formation in the macula of both eyes (Panels A and B).
Transient visual obscurations are a common symptom of papilledema and typically last only seconds. The direct ophthalmoscope is useful in the clinical examination of these patients.
